I am considering buying a clio 172 turbo to use as a donor for parts to turbo my 172 cup..

The 172 turbo has been done using a k-tec kit, but runs a k-tec low pressure turbo ecu (not gen90), which i am led to believe is a standard ecu...?

The plan is to return the 172 turbo to standard and put the kit onto my cup, so I have a couple of compatibility questions....

Will the two sumps be ok to swap? - presuming the oil return is tapped into the sump
Will the ECU's just simply swap over or is it going to be a lot more complicated.
Is there anything else that wont simply swap oveR?

I know this running this ECU on a turbo is not ideal, but I want to get it done and running so I can sell the 'ex-turbo' 172 and will improve the turbo'd cup in time.

thanks
 
  182/RS2/ Turbo/Mk1
What car is the turbo?

If its a ph1 for example the ecu wont work with electronic throttle.

You could just put an rs tuner map on it though to put it back to standard.

Yes all sumps for 172/182 are interchangable

If you do swap the ecu's (assuming they are same type) you'll need to swap the UCH and keys over too.
